Factoring in the 'unknown unknowns': why new multidisciplinary risk management models are needed in light of the Japanese earthquake
Published 03/22/11
Michelle Tuveson, Executive Director of the Centre for Risk Studies, says decision-making in risk management relies on cultural perceptions of how we perceive those 'threats'. However she warns that risk must not be observed from a parochial point of view; it must be seen from a global view point.
